Spoof spy movie featuring Steve Carell, the boss in the US version of
The Office. Much of the humor draws from the spies exposing their everyday human side. Good laughs! Only reproach: it's a bit of a work-out for the eyes—I didn't need all the special effects.

An ambitious professional receives the mission of inviting an "idiot" for dinner to entertain his boss. Many laughs in this Hollywood adaptation of
The Dinner Game, one of the funniest movies ever, but the US version pales in comparison to the French original. Well, it's Hollywood, and they just
had to show the dinner—easily the weakest scene in the movie; it truly is a dinner for shmucks, and the shmucks are the Hollywood people who asked for the dinner scene. Oh, and the movie also had to feature an utterly stupid romance. On the redeeming side, I was thrilled to see Jemaine Clement, a brilliant New Zealand actor (
Flight of the Conchords,
Eagle vs Shark).

Bruce, a man who complains that God is persecuting him, finally meets God, who gives him the job of being God to see if he can do it better. After playing with his super powers, Bruce, who is only given a small section of Buffalo (New York) to start with, finds out that the job is not as easy as it sounds. This movie makes me chuckle a lot. The one scene that made me laugh out loud actually features Steve Carell in the lead, but Jim Carrey does a great job. For my taste, the ending scenes are a tad on the exalted side, but given the theme it could have been a lot worse.

Once a week, to overcome the routine, a married couple with two turbulent kids hire a baby-sitter and treat themselves to their "date night"—usually a tame affair at a local family restaurant. One week, on a whim, they drive to nearby Manhattan, where everything goes terribly wrong and they soon find themselves chased by blood-thirsty mobsters. The two lead actors did a good job and the film had funny moments, but there was too much filler in between. The cast cannot be blamed for the tiresome plot. I'd suggest skipping this one.

Dad is bankrupt, mom wants a divorce, grandpa snorts heroin, uncle Frank has just tried to kill himself, big brother doesn't speak, but everyone piles up in a VW van to bring little sister to a beauty pageant in California. Great story about who we are, and splendid acting, not least by Alan Arkin, who was already an amazing actor forty years earlier in
The Russians are Coming, the Russians are Coming.

A teenager spending the Summer in Cape Cod escapes his family by taking a job at a water park. This is certainly not a laugh-out-loud comedy, but it's a good movie in the light-hearted movie. I did have a couple of good laughs thanks to the character of the water park supervisor (Sam Rockwell), who carries the bulk of the film's comedic power.
